In the sections below, I intend to summarize the guidelines provided by the Joana Briggs Institute for conducting a … WebJun 15, 2024 · Similar to a systematic review, a scoping review is a type of review that tries to minimize bias by using transparent and repeatable methods. However, a scoping review isn’t a type of systematic review. The most important difference is the goal: rather than answering a specific question, a scoping review explores a topic.
